WALES — The driver of a dump truck hauling gravel was killed Friday morning when the truck rolled over on Route 126. Chief Deputy William Gagne of the Androscoggin County Sheriff’s Office said investigators are looking into the possibility that a medical issue caused the crash. The truck was headed toward Monmouth shortly before 7 a.m. […]
